Fujitsu General Introduces Stylish ‘Soft Black’ Wall Mount for AIRSTAGE Range

Fujitsu General Air Conditioning UK has expanded its AIRSTAGE wall mount range with a new 'soft-black' version. This new unit (model ASEH**KMCG-B) can be connected to both split and multi-split systems and operates on the lower GWP R32 refrigerant, with capacities ranging from 2 to 4.2kW.

One of the standout features of the new model is its compact design, with a chassis depth of just 220mm. This is achieved through the innovative high-density multipath heat exchanger. Additionally, the unit boasts built-in Wi-Fi, which allows it to be controlled via the AIRSTAGE Mobile app. Service and maintenance are also simplified, as refrigerant cycle data can be displayed on a compatible wired controller.

The unit offers impressive performance, with cooling capabilities down to -10°C and up to 50°C, and heating starting from -15°C. It achieves a high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ER) of up to 8.4 in heating mode and a Seasonal Coefficient of Performance (SCOP) of 4.6 for cooling, thanks to its large louvre design.

Efficiency and quiet operation are enhanced by the large cross-flow fan, which ensures effective airflow at noise levels as low as 20dB(A) in cooling mode. Installation is made easier and more cost-effective with a 20m pipe length and 10m elevation capability, and the units are pre-charged for 15m of pipework, eliminating potential additional installation costs for refrigerant charges.

The unit also features an ion deodorising filter and an apple catechin filter, both of which help to break down odours and capture fine dust particles using static electricity.

Commenting on the launch, Martyn Ives, Commercial Director at Fujitsu, said: “The soft-black unit certainly attracted a lot of attention on the stand at InstallerSHOW. The matt texture of the fascia means that it doesn’t reflect ceiling lights as the mirror-style units do and it fits in with what customers are demanding in terms of interior design.”
